			            Original DescriptionIn John Downman's delicate 18th-century portrait The Poet's Muses, we encounter an exquisite moment of romantic reverie captured with the lightness of Rococo sensibility. Painted circa 1780—the golden age of English portraiture—the watercolor and chalk work showcases Downman's signature ethereal touch, portraying muses not as grand allegorical figures but as dreamy, intimate presences wrapped in flowing drapery. Their faces glow with poetic inspiration while soft washes of color create rhythmic harmony between figures and negative space, exemplifying the transition from formal Baroque to more personal Romantic expressions. Though less renowned than his contemporaries Reynolds or Gainsborough, Downman's muses embody the era's fascination with literary romanticism and creative introspection, making this piece a charming testament to the quiet intimacy of Georgian aesthetics.
